Recalling the Details: What Was It All About?

So, what exactly do people talk about during those crucial first encounters? The possibilities are as diverse and unique as the individuals involved. However, some common threads often emerge. In many cases, the first conversation revolves around practicalities – introductions, names, backgrounds, and perhaps the context in which the meeting occurred. If it's a chance encounter, there might be some lighthearted banter about the situation itself. If it's a meeting arranged through friends or a dating app, there might be initial icebreakers and attempts to find common ground. These preliminary exchanges serve to establish a basic level of familiarity and comfort, paving the way for deeper conversation.

Beyond the practicalities, the first conversation often delves into shared interests and passions. People are naturally drawn to those who share their enthusiasm for certain topics, hobbies, or activities. So, it's common for initial interactions to revolve around music, movies, books, travel, sports, or other mutual interests. These discussions not only provide a sense of connection but also offer glimpses into the other person's personality and values. A shared love for classic literature might indicate a thoughtful and intellectual nature, while a passion for outdoor adventures might suggest a free-spirited and adventurous personality.

For some, the first conversation might delve into deeper topics, exploring personal beliefs, values, or experiences. This might involve discussions about family, career aspirations, life goals, or even philosophical questions. These conversations can be particularly meaningful, as they allow individuals to share their authentic selves and connect on a more profound level. However, it's important to note that the depth of the first conversation will vary depending on the individuals involved and the context of the meeting. Some people are naturally more open and forthcoming, while others prefer to take a more cautious approach. The key is to find a balance between sharing authentically and respecting each other's boundaries.

Rekindling the Flame: Revisiting the First Conversation

Whether your first conversation is a vivid memory or a hazy recollection, revisiting it can be a valuable exercise for any couple. It's a chance to reminisce about the early days of your relationship, relive the emotions you felt, and appreciate how far you've come. It can also provide insights into the foundation of your connection and help you understand the qualities that drew you to each other in the first place. Maybe it was their quick wit, their infectious laughter, their genuine empathy, or their shared passion for a particular cause. Whatever it was, revisiting these early memories can rekindle the flame of your love and remind you of the unique bond you share.

To revisit your first conversation, try creating a cozy and intimate setting. Perhaps light some candles, put on some soft music, and pour a glass of wine. Then, take turns sharing your memories of that first encounter. What do you remember most vividly? What were your initial impressions of each other? What were you feeling at the time? Don't be afraid to laugh, to share silly details, and to get a little sentimental. This is a chance to celebrate your love story and appreciate the journey you've taken together.

If your memories are a bit hazy, don't worry. You can still have a meaningful conversation about what you think might have transpired. What kind of topics would you have been likely to discuss? What kind of questions would you have asked? What were your general interests and values at that time? Even if you can't recall the exact words, you can still gain insights into the early dynamics of your relationship.
